English Lesson Plan - Week 3

 
WEEK 3 (Monday)

 

Grammer Outline:



  • This is straight-forward stuff. Make the copies and give them to the students.
  • Do this exercises 1-2 in class and then assign the one below for hw
  • Have each student do the sheet by him/herself.
  • Ask students to compare answers and discuss differences, each student trying to explain his/her choice.
  • Correct sheet as a class. Review each grammar point quickly - you should get a lot of "Oh, yeah....".
  • Give the students an unmarked copy of the same exercise to repeat at home to solidify the review exercise.
